Skinvisible, Inc. (OTCBB: SKVI) is a company that has been around since 1999. No reverse splits, no prefererred shares, 92.09 million shares out.
They have seen the need for a virus killing hand sanitizer that lasts for hours and hours. You know the clear squirt liquids you currently use only last seconds. They are good, but for seconds – not up to four hours. Further, they dry hands. Does that not make your hands even more absorbent when a virus is introduced?
DermSafe is the product of Skinvisible research. They have a laboratory on site, and they do an incredible amount of product development and testing. After several years, the product is ready to go. It is called DermSafe. It is a hand sanitizer you squirt on your hands, rub in, and you now have up to four hours of protection. If a virus is introduced to your hands – like H1N1 – it is killed instantly. Even if you wash your hands, this does not come off. Skinvisible has developed some exclusive polymers that bind it to your skin for hours.
Approved in Canada; a step away from approval in the UK and the EU; a step away from approval in China; the company is moving it into many markets world wide. The US is not there yet. Our FDA is careful. Please refer to their latest press release for the status there. Skinvisible has many products available world wide. Do not think this is just about a product in the US.
